You may also recall that some pals and I challenge ourselves to complete a journal page per week, we've been doing this since JUNE!!! I've managed most weeks but, sadly, not all ... life just gets in the way sometimes. We offer a one word prompt to get us all going and this week's prompt is ... "LIFE"
My Journal page
And a closer view to show the foiling detail
Materials used:
  • One page of my Crawford and Black journal (£1 from The Works)
  • Liquitex modelling paste applied through a Stamplorations stencil (ARTSL1002 - shutters) using a palette knife and then set aside to dry
  • Medici mixed media shimmer spray in tanzanite spritzed over brusho's in black and lemon .. with a little additional water
  • White gesso applied through a Dylusions circle stencil (using a baby wipe) to knock back the density of the colourSentiments (Stamplorations from the "Discover" set and the "Noteworthy" set) stamped using Versafine onyx black ink, sprinkled with clear embossing powder and heat set
  • Using my WRMK "heatwave" tool and pink foil I added some random swirls and embellishments to my stencilled and brusho'd page
  • Painters Paint Pens in purple and white used to doodle a border and to add a few doodles
